Attaining Core Content for English Language Learners (ACCELL) supports teachers in implementing routines and scaffolds that serve the dual purpose of helping ELLs meet English language proficiency standards and content standards.
AIR played a key role in developing Education at a Glance 2013, a report produced by the Organization for Economic Cooperation and Development (OECD). The report analyzes the education systems of the 34 OECD member countries and eight partner countries.

Enrollment in teacher preparation programs has been declining since 2010 and the teacher workforce is aging; meanwhile, K-12 enrollment is growing. But, AIR's Alex Berg-Jacobson, Jesse Levin, and Jim Lindsay argue in this blog post that those commonly quoted statistics about teacher supply and demand don't tell the whole story. ...
